I bought a replacement boot for the hydraulic cylinder on the cubs touch control.
The thing is tiny and I have no clue what it is for. I simply cleaned up the old leather boot and reinstalled.
The one for the spool valve fit great on the other hand.

The later touch controls only used a boot over the knuckle, not the cylinder, and if you order one from IH dealer the new one is what you get. If you order one for Super A it will fit over the cylinder, or TM Tractor, one of the site sponsors also sells the full size boot. If you have a touch control that originally used the small boot, it does not have the groove on the lip to hold the boot in place at the extension on the casting.

The small boot goes over the rod on the main cylinder and fits inside the cylinder, this keeps the water and dirt from getting to the pivot on the rod inside the cylinder
